Health Advice Kitten Diarrhea
Just wanna say thank you if you take the time to read this!! My first ragdoll kitten is a 14 week blue bicolor boy 🩵 We love him soooo much & he’s the sweetest cat I’ve ever known. We took him home a week and a half ago! We fed him the same food as the breeder did (access to Royal Canin Kitten Dry 24/7 and 3-4 wet meals of the Royal Canin Kitten Loaf in Sauce. She was also doing a fancy feast but we didn’t see that until after we started him on Royal Canin. He had perfect poops/pees the first 2 days but then on day 2, he went to the vet. The vet accidentally gave him an extra FVRCP booster shot (his 4th dose) when he had just had his 3rd dose the week before :( we had no idea how many/how frequent they should be until we reached out to the breeder and she was confused why they did that. She apologized and said maybe that could have triggered his immune system but it’s hard to tell. ALSO, the breeder said his litter was one of the only litters that had ZERO diarrhea issues. That being said, on day 3 he started to have liquid diarrhea. It rotates between some formed poops then liquid. He’s only going 1-2 times a day, not straining. Normal pees. He got a fecal exam and everything came back good on friday 7/31 but she recommend the probiotic fontiflora. That seemed like it helped slightly by Sunday but then called the vet Monday 8/3 and said he’s been having the diarrhea still (and stepping in it lol). Her next steps were to cut the wet food until Wednesday 8/5 to see if that firmed him up. That only gave him less firm poops and more consistent liquid poops. I weighed him yesterday (see bowl pic lol) and he actually went from 2.79 7/28 -> 2.76 8/5. It was concerning to me because when we cut the wet he really wasn’t eating a lot and seemed lower energy. I decided to slowly start to reintroduce the wet food back with 2 10g servings yesterday and he had a normal poop last night then followed by some diarrhea a few hours later (back to his normal diarrhea schedule). I am tracking his dry food today to figure out his daily intake and continuing to weigh him. Looking for some insight if anyone has gone through something similar. The vet doesn’t seem too concerned and neither does my sister who is also a vet. She thinks it’s still an adjustment and due to the vaccine potentially. He still plays a bunch and sleeps like regular kitten. Thank you for any advice and insight!!! From, A Concerned First-Time Ragdoll Mommy
